Output dd26cd12e07a39bac6305413c1544a8be4b2c0b170ea12e18dfea522c8b58b05:0

value
83596695
script pubkey
OP_0 OP_PUSHBYTES_20 161bfb6d4511de94e56c4d33df2bd3b687723698
address
ltc1qzcdlkm29z80ffetvf5ea727nk6rhyd5c3gjww5
transaction
dd26cd12e07a39bac6305413c1544a8be4b2c0b170ea12e18dfea522c8b58b05
spent
true